PROCEDURE
实验过程
To a solution of 3-cyanobenzoic acid (12.3 g, 0.083 mol) in toluene (300 mL) were added sodium azide (16 g, 0.25 mol) and triethylamine hydrochloride (34 g, 0.25 mol) respectively. The reaction mixture was refluxed for 4 hours, cooled to room temperature, and diluted with water (300 mL). The organic phase was separated and the aqueous portion was acidified (pH=1) using concentrated HCl. The precipitate was collected by filtration and oven-dried to give 14 g (89%) of the tetrazole as a white solid. CI-MS: C8H6N4O2 [M+1] 191.0. The product obtained (14 g, 0.074 mol) was suspended in anhydrous methanol followed by the addition of gaseous HCl over a period of 20 minutes. The warm solution was stirred at room temperature for overnight, then concentrated in vacuo. The resulting residue was triturated with diethyl ether and collected by filtration to yield 12.1 g (81%) of the methyl ester intermediate 2. CI-MS: C9H8N4O2 [M+1] 205.2
